International Conference 19th Ružička Days was traditionally held in Vukovar, Croatia, on the 21th and 23rd September 2022 under the slogan “TODAY SCIENCE TOMORROW INDUSTRY”.
The conference was organized by the Croatian Society of Chemical Engineers (CSCE) and its partners, Faculty of Food Technology of University of Josip Juraj Strossmayer in Osijek, European Chemical Society (EuCheMS), and European Hygienic Engineering & Design Group (EHEDG) .

The “Ružička’s Days” is a traditional review of scientific activity from the field of chemistry, chemical & biochemical engineering, materials science and engineering, and related sciences, dedicated to the memory of the famous Croatian chemist and first Croatian Nobel Prize laureate professor Lavoslav (Leopold) Ružička.

The topic of the 19th meeting is “Today Science – Tommorow Industry” since the organizing committee wishes to emphasize the importance of the implementation of science research and achievements. The program was included plenary lectures of invited renowned speakers and scientific poster sessions.

Silvija Šafranko, ByProExtract team member, stayed on the Institute of Pharmaceutical Technology and Biopharmacy in Pecs (University of Pecs) within the ERASMUS academic exchange program for (non) teaching staff for a month. This exchange is a continuation of good cooperation between the Faculty of Food Technology and Engineering in Osijek and the Institute of Pharmaceutical Technology and Biopharmacy in Pecs.
During her stay, Silvija has been working on the investigation of innovative and new methods for the by-products utilization, mainly of Citrus clementina peels, for the pharmaceutical purpose. Primarily, this included the fundamental understanding of the meta ion-phenolic acid complexation, but also studies on the thermodynamic and kinetic influences on the complex formation.

First Meeting of Young Chemical Engineers took place in February 1996. on Faculty of Chemical Engineering and Technology, University of Zagreb. Since then, it regularly takes place every two years. The Meeting was conceived as a conference where young chemical engineers, and engineers of related professions, can gain first experiences in presenting results of their research.
